WebGregor Mendel knew how to keep things simple. In Mendel's work on pea plants, each gene came in just two different versions, or alleles, and these alleles had a nice, clear-cut dominance relationship (with the dominant allele fully overriding the recessive allele to determine the plant's appearance). In fact, … rawson featherbrookeWebMay 25, 2014 · 4. Perfect Matching Problem. Given a graph G = (V,E), a matching M in G is a set of pairwise non-adjacent edges; that is, no two edges share a common vertex. A perfect matching is a matching which matches all vertices of the graph.
